Verse in context — Hosea 11

6

And the sword shall abide on his cities, and shall consume his branches, and devour [them], because of their own counsels.

7

And my people are bent to backsliding from me: though they called them to the most High, none at all would exalt [him].

8

How shall I give thee up, Ephraim? [how] shall I deliver thee, Israel? how shall I make thee as Admah? [how] shall I set thee as Zeboim? mine heart is turned within me, my repentings are kindled together.

9

I will not execute the fierceness of mine anger, I will not return to destroy Ephraim: for I [am] God, and not man; the Holy One in the midst of thee: and I will not enter into the city.

10

They shall walk after the LORD: he shall roar like a lion: when he shall roar, then the children shall tremble from the west.
